Blueberry Cheesecake Rolls

  • Total Time: 35 minutes
  • Yield: 8 servings 1x

Ingredients

  • 1 package Refrigerated crescent roll dough
  • 1 cup Fresh blueberries
  • 1/4 cup Granulated sugar
  • 1 tbsp Cornstarch
  • 1 tsp Lemon juice
  • 8 oz Cream cheese (softened)
  • 1/4 cup Powdered sugar
  • 1 tsp Vanilla extract
  • 1 tbsp Butter (melted)
  • 1/4 cup Graham cracker crumbs

Instructions

  • Preheat the Oven: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C). Line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
  • Prepare the Blueberry Mixture: In a small saucepan, combine the blueberries, granulated sugar, cornstarch, and lemon juice. Cook over medium heat, stirring occasionally, until the mixture thickens and the blueberries start to burst. Remove from heat and let cool.
  • Make the Cheesecake Filling: In a medium bowl, beat the softened cream cheese, powdered sugar, and vanilla extract until smooth.
  • Assemble the Rolls: Unroll the crescent roll dough and separate it into triangles. Spread a layer of cheesecake filling on each triangle, then add a spoonful of the blueberry mixture.
  • Roll and Bake: Starting at the wide end, roll up each triangle and place them on the prepared baking sheet. Brush the rolls with melted butter and sprinkle with graham cracker crumbs. Bake for 12-15 minutes, or until golden brown.
  • Cool and Serve: Allow the rolls to cool slightly before serving.

Notes

  • Don’t overfill the rolls to prevent them from bursting during baking.
  • Let the blueberry mixture cool before adding it to the dough for the best consistency.
